Topic: Family Matters: Intergenerational Wealth Transfer

This presentation shares strategies and concepts to help Canadians prepare for a tax-optimized wealth transfer to their heirs or intended beneficiaries. Here's an overview of some key concepts that will be discussed:

  • Strategies to minimize tax and bypass probate

  • Cascading concept

  • Maintaining family harmony

  • Estate Trustee and Power of Attorney (POA) roles and responsibilities

  • Estate privacy when transferring wealth

  • Beneficiaries and successor owners

  • Intergenerational wealth transfer strategies

  • Inheritance planning

  • Trust basics and reasons to consider trusts
